Keys to the Kingdom

0 4 min 6 yrs

By Callie Mitchell, SAVED News International Correspondent, Jerusalem, Israel One thing I love about living in Israel is how experiencing the culture often allows me to discover depth of meaning in God’s word almost accidentally! Of course, it’s really through the Lord’s sovereignty, but sometimes […]

Featured